摘要
The present paper follows closely the emerging trend of developing solutions that can replace the existing combustion engines in the automotive industry. In addition to the existing skills published already, the paper details the itinerary of the process, starting from the concept, following with the design, validation via simulations and experimental tests of the proposed solution. This is based on a switched reluctance machine together with its proper power electronics and wise control strategies in that diminish the drawback caused by the machine's torque ripples. The contribution of the paper to the actual status of the research in this field is the complete solution of switched reluctance machine extendable to any ratings that are demanded by the automotive industry.
